Hi,
My birt viewer is under tomcat 5.5 webapps.
I have a report with report parameters, account and password, to connect
to database. Everything is doing just fine with correct account and
password. However, when the aoount/password is wrong, the viewer show up
the report title and got no error message or data.
I've tried the report at Eclipse. if the password is wrong, I can get
error message something like "failed to get connection". And I also turn
the viewer log to FINEST, the "failed to get connection" message exist in
the log file. Don't know how to let the error message response to the
browser, otherwise users got no idea is there errors or no data.
Any idea? please help Thank you
